Job Title:
Technical Engineer
Location: Riyadh, Saudi Arabia
Company Overview:
Riyadh Cables Group is the leading manufacturer of electrical wires and cables in the MENA region, offering innovative power transmission and communication solutions that fuel sustainable development. Our commitment to environmentally responsible practices and cutting-edge technology drives progress across infrastructure, energy, and industrial sectors.
We are an equal opportunity employer and value diversity in our workforce with a dynamic environment that encourages growth, innovation, and sustainability.
Roles and Responsibilities:
Participate in the implementation of plans and programs to ensure internal development and increased productivity.
Support the development of the technical work plan, schedules, and workflow to improve efficiency and maintain team harmony.
Supervise, analyze, and recommend improvements for products, designs, and costs to enhance competitiveness.
Assist in the design and development of new products and ensure functionality aligns with requirements.
Coordinate with procurement for prototype materials and oversee new model designs.
Conduct technical analysis of competitor products.
Provide technical support to sales and marketing teams in product presentations and customer interactions.
Identify and report implementation issues affecting timelines or budgets.
Support manufacturing to ensure products are fabricated per design intent.
Develop and maintain technical procedures related to core machine technologies.
Collaborate with internal teams and customers to define technical needs and solutions.
Prepare periodic reports on technical activities and ensure smooth departmental operations.
Conduct meetings and performance evaluations for subordinates, manage administrative affairs, and carry out other tasks assigned by the Technical Manager.
Job Requirements:
B.Sc. in Electrical Engineering.
Minimum of 0-2 years experience, preferably in wires & cables or utility industry.
Professional knowledge in Product Design, Cable Technology, Manufacturing Practices, Industrial and Quality Standards, and Product Development Life Cycle.
Strong skills in supervision, analysis, communication, problem-solving, interpersonal relations, follow-up, and cost-quality awareness.
Excellent command of the English language.
Completed advanced training in Cable Manufacturing Technology, Product Design, Product Development Life Cycle, and design-related computer applications.
